未指定数据库用户名是什么

飞飞 其他 1

回复

共3条回复 我来回复
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    未指定数据库用户名是指在连接数据库时没有明确指定要使用的用户名。在大多数情况下,连接数据库时需要提供用户名和密码以进行身份验证。如果未指定用户名,系统将无法确定要使用哪个用户进行连接,从而导致连接失败。

    以下是关于未指定数据库用户名的几点说明:

    1. 连接数据库的常见方式:连接数据库时,通常会使用一种特定的数据库连接字符串来指定要连接的数据库服务器、数据库名称、用户名和密码等信息。在这种情况下,如果未在连接字符串中指定用户名,则系统将无法确定要使用哪个用户进行连接。

    2. 默认用户名:某些数据库系统在安装时会自动创建一个默认的用户名,例如MySQL中的"root"用户、PostgreSQL中的"postgres"用户等。如果未指定用户名,系统可能会默认使用这些默认用户名进行连接。

    3. 身份验证失败:如果未指定用户名,或者指定的用户名无效,则系统将无法验证连接的身份,从而导致连接失败。数据库系统通常会返回一个错误消息,指示连接失败的原因。

    4. 安全性考虑:在实际应用中,为了提高数据库的安全性,通常会为每个用户创建一个独立的用户名和密码,并为其分配适当的权限。通过明确指定用户名,可以确保只有授权的用户可以连接和操作数据库,从而减少潜在的安全风险。

    5. 解决方法:要解决未指定数据库用户名的问题,可以在连接数据库时明确指定要使用的用户名。具体的方法取决于所使用的数据库系统和编程语言。例如,在使用MySQL连接数据库时,可以在连接字符串中指定用户名,或者在代码中使用相应的API方法来设置用户名。

    4个月前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    如果未指定数据库用户名,则可能会使用默认的数据库用户名。不同的数据库系统有不同的默认用户名。

    对于一些常见的数据库系统,它们的默认用户名如下:

    1. MySQL:默认用户名是"root"。
    2. PostgreSQL:默认用户名是"postgres"。
    3. Oracle:默认用户名是"sys"。
    4. Microsoft SQL Server:默认用户名是"sa"。

    需要注意的是,这些默认用户名在安装数据库系统时会自动创建。为了安全起见,建议在生产环境中更改默认用户名,并为每个用户分配独立的权限。

    如果未指定数据库用户名,可以尝试使用这些默认用户名进行连接。如果连接失败,可能需要参考数据库系统的文档或联系数据库管理员获取正确的用户名。

    4个月前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    如果未指定数据库用户名,通常会使用默认的数据库用户。不同的数据库管理系统有不同的默认用户名。

    以下是一些常见数据库管理系统的默认用户名:

    1. MySQL:默认用户名是"root"。在安装MySQL后,可以使用root用户来进行数据库管理和操作。

    2. Oracle:默认用户名是"SYS"和"SYSTEM"。这两个用户是Oracle数据库中的特殊用户,用于管理和维护数据库。

    3. PostgreSQL:默认用户名是"postgres"。在安装PostgreSQL后,可以使用postgres用户来进行数据库管理和操作。

    4. Microsoft SQL Server:默认用户名是"sa"。在安装SQL Server后,可以使用sa用户来进行数据库管理和操作。

    5. MongoDB:默认情况下,MongoDB没有用户名和密码。如果没有指定用户名和密码,可以直接连接到MongoDB数据库。

    请注意,这些默认用户名是在安装数据库管理系统时设置的,实际情况可能会因为不同的安装选项而有所变化。在实际使用中,建议根据安装文档或系统管理员的指示来确定默认用户名。

    4个月前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部